    W2 for Employee

    I recently was told that I can't use a pen on a paper w2 I picked up in town because I need to have a certain printer or typewriter? So I was told to go online and register with my EIN and do it that way. Can you give me the website of where I do this and if it is the irs.gov site front page w2 link, that is 11 pages long. Must I type the same thing over and over again with just one employee?

    Do I need to do anything with a w3?

    W-2 and W-3

    Yes, you cannot file out these forms by hand. They must be typed. (what a pain)

    Yes, you must type the same info over and over, even for one employee.

    You do need to file W-3. That's the form that gets sent to Social Security to report on how much you withheld and paid for Social Security taxes for this employee.
